摘要:
阅读全文
摘要:
阅读全文
摘要:
阅读全文
摘要:
在Web和App项目中,缓存的使用无处不在。它的使用,无非就是为了缓解两大耗时黑户对用户体验的影响,同时尽量地减少服务器的负担: 对磁盘的访问 网络访问 对磁盘的访问 网络访问 (原创文章,转载请注明转自Clement-Xu的csdn博客。) 所以,缓存的引入一般都是为了减少这两个访问的次数。由于互 阅读全文
摘要:
Java中最简单的LRU算法实现,就是利用 LinkedHashMap,覆写其中的removeEldestEntry(Map.Entry)方法即可 如果你去看LinkedHashMap的源码可知,LRU算法是通过双向链表来实现,当某个位置被命中,通过调整链表的指向将该位置调整到头位置,新加入的内容直 阅读全文